Product Installation Instructions for Motorcycle Cylinder Clutch Generator Cover Gasket

Tools You Will Need:

  1. Socket Wrench Set - To remove and install the screws securing the engine cover.
  2. Torque Wrench - To ensure that screws are tightened to the manufacturer’s specifications.
  3. Screwdriver Set - For any additional screws that may require a screwdriver instead of a socket wrench.
  4. Pliers - In case any components need adjustments or removal.
  5. Clean Rags - For wiping excess oil and ensuring the work area is clean.
  6. Gasket Scraper or Razor Blade - To remove old gasket material from the surfaces.
  7. Engine Oil - To lubricate screws and ensure proper sealing upon reinstallation.
  8. Safety Goggles and Gloves - For protection during the installation process.

Installation Steps:

  1. Prepare Your Workspace:

    • Make sure the motorcycle is stable and secure. Lay down a clean cloth to catch any debris and oil.
  2. Remove the Old Gasket:

    • Use the gasket scraper or razor blade to carefully remove the old gasket material from the engine cover and the engine casing. Ensure the surfaces are smooth and clean.
  3. Clean the Area:

    • Wipe down the surfaces with clean rags to remove any oil residue and dirt.
  4. Install the New Gasket:

    • Place the new cylinder clutch generator cover gasket onto the engine casing, making sure it aligns perfectly with the bolt holes and the contours of the engine.
  5. Reattach the Cover:

    • Carefully position the engine cover back onto the engine, ensuring that the gasket remains in place.
  6. Secure the Cover:

    • Using the socket wrench, tighten the screws in a crisscross pattern to ensure even pressure distribution. Refer to your owner’s manual for the correct torque specifications.
  7. Final Check:

    • Once the cover is secured, double-check that all screws are tight and that there is no debris between the gasket and the engine.
  8. Start the Engine:

    • After installation, start the engine and inspect for any leaks. Take a short ride to ensure everything is functioning correctly.

By following these steps and using the appropriate tools, you can successfully install the Motorcycle Cylinder Clutch Generator Cover Gasket with ease. Enjoy your ride!
